The Department of Veterans Affairs is seeking a contractor for elevator maintenance and repair services at the Syracuse VA Medical Center. This opportunity includes a base term and four optional extensions, focusing on ensuring the operational efficiency and safety of elevator systems.
The buyer aims to establish a reliable maintenance service to ensure the elevators at the Syracuse VAMC are functional and compliant with safety standards. This is critical for patient care and facility operations.
